About Program

Program Overview


This online MSc Management program empowers aspiring leaders to advance their careers while working full-time. Its comprehensive curriculum covers strategic management, operations, and sought-after areas like marketing and sustainability. Students collaborate globally, engage in research-led teaching, and develop critical skills for leadership roles in various industries. The flexible learning environment and multiple start dates provide convenience and accessibility.

Program Outline


Degree Overview:

Its comprehensive curriculum covers a broad range of management topics, preparing graduates for leadership positions in various business settings. The program is specifically structured to allow students to continue working full-time while studying, enabling them to fast-track their professional development without career disruption.


Outline:

Students collaborate with peers from across the globe through discussion groups, online forums, and independent study. The curriculum consists of core modules focused on strategic management and operational challenges, alongside optional modules in sought-after areas like marketing and sustainability. Each module is assessed through a combination of coursework, presentations, and group work, ensuring a comprehensive evaluation of acquired knowledge and skills.


Assessment:


Student progress is assessed through a variety of methods, including:

  • Coursework: Assignments and projects designed to test understanding of key concepts and application of learned skills.
  • Presentations: Opportunities to showcase research findings and demonstrate communication abilities.
  • Group work: Collaborative projects fostering teamwork and problem-solving skills.

Teaching:

Students benefit from research-led teaching and close guidance from dedicated Student Success Coordinators. The flexible learning environment allows for independent study and online interaction with classmates and faculty.


Careers:


The program emphasizes the development of critical skills valued by employers, including:

  • Strategic leadership: Ability to make informed decisions in complex environments.
  • Operations management: Expertise in designing and managing efficient operations.
  • Financial analysis: Interpreting and utilizing financial data for effective decision-making.
  • Strategic marketing: Planning and executing marketing strategies for competitive advantage.
  • People management: Leading and motivating teams in diverse organizational settings.
  • Sustainability: Understanding and implementing sustainable business practices.

Other:


Here are some additional key points about the program:

  • Start dates: Six start dates per year provide flexibility for students to begin when convenient.
  • Government postgraduate loan: Available for eligible UK and EU students.
  • Keele alumni discount: 10% tuition fee reduction for Keele graduates, bringing the total cost to £6,966.

Additional modules students can choose from include:

  • Brand Management for Strategic Success
  • Green Finance
  • Marketing Research for Contemporary Management
  • Contemporary Case Studies in Sustainability

Total programme fees: £7,740 Per 15-credit module fee: £645 If you are based in the UK or the EU, you may be eligible for a government postgraduate loan to cover the full costs of the course.

Keele University: A Summary


Overview:

Keele University is a public research university located in Staffordshire, England. Established over 70 years ago, it is renowned for its wide range of teaching and research, tackling global issues. Keele is known for its commitment to sustainability and its positive impact on the local economy.


Services Offered:


Student Life and Campus Experience:

Keele University offers a vibrant campus experience. Students can expect a beautiful setting in the Staffordshire countryside, just five miles from Stoke-on-Trent. The university is known for its strong sense of community and its commitment to student well-being.


Key Reasons to Study There:

    Research Excellence:

    Keele University is recognized for its high-quality research, with 80% of its research classified as world-leading or internationally excellent.

    Teaching Excellence:

    The university has achieved a Gold award in the Teaching Excellence Framework, demonstrating its commitment to providing excellent teaching and learning experiences.

    Student Satisfaction:

    Keele University has been ranked number one in the UK by students, according to Studentcrowd.

    Sustainability Focus:

    Keele is dedicated to sustainability and has a strong commitment to environmental responsibility.

    Strong Local Impact:

    The university contributes significantly to the local economy, generating £345 million annually.

Academic Programs:


Other:

Keele University is a modern university that has played a significant role in shaping higher education in Britain. It offers a wide range of undergraduate and postgraduate programs across various disciplines. The university is also a partner with the NHS, providing opportunities for students to gain practical experience in healthcare.

Admission Requirements

Entry Requirements:


Home and EU Students:

  • Minimum of a 2:2 UK undergraduate degree or equivalent international qualification.
  • Third-class honours degree or an ordinary degree (without honours) or UK equivalent professional qualification with a minimum of two years' appropriate work experience.
  • Applicants without a recognized degree must provide evidence of at least two years' relevant work experience.

International Students (Outside EU):

  • Minimum of a 2:2 UK undergraduate degree or equivalent international qualification.
  • Third-class honours degree or an ordinary degree (without honours) or UK equivalent professional qualification with a minimum of three years' appropriate work experience.
  • Applicants without a recognized degree must provide evidence of at least three years' relevant work experience.
  • Accepted qualifications include:
  • IELTS: 6.0 overall with no individual component below 5.5
  • TOEFL: 79 overall
  • PTE Academic: 50 overall
  • Cambridge (CCAE & CPE): 169 overall with minimum scores of 162 in Listening, Reading, Writing and Speaking
  • Duolingo: 95 overall with minimum 85 in each element
  • A degree qualification taught in English and completed within the last two years

Technical Requirements:

  • Desktop computer or laptop with a current operating system
  • Up-to-date web browser (Microsoft Edge, Mozilla Firefox, Google Chrome)

Additional Notes:

  • MSc Management with Data Analytics students may require additional software such as Python.
